In today's volatile energy market, savvy individuals are actively seeking ways to control their energy expenditures. Smart pricing strategies offer a powerful solution by synchronizing energy usage with periods of lower electricity rates. One popular approach involves utilizing time-of-use (TOU) tariffs, where power costs vary depending on the time of day or week.

  • Understanding your energy consumption patterns is crucial for utilizing smart pricing strategies effectively.
  • Analyzing past energy bills can uncover peak usage periods, allowing you to modify energy-intensive tasks to off-peak hours.
  • Considering smart home devices and appliances can greatly automate the process of lowering energy consumption during costly periods.

Energy Efficiency Strategies: Pricing Structures for Sustainability

As the global community strives towards a sustainable future, implementing energy efficiency has emerged as a crucial objective. Pricing models play a pivotal role in incentivizing consumers to adopt more sustainable practices. Innovative pricing structures can effectively stimulate energy conservation by adjusting the true cost of energy consumption. By implementing time-of-use tariffs, for instance, consumers are incentivized to shift their energy usage to off-peak hours, thereby minimizing peak demand and enhancing grid stability.
